一种基于WIFI信号强度的室内定位方法技术

技术编号:11597331 阅读:299 留言:0更新日期:2015-06-12 09:15
本发明专利技术提供一种基于WIFI信号强度的室内定位方法,具体过程为:在室内环境选取若干采样点,采集采样点处WIFI信号的强度信息,得到位置指纹库;采集待定位点WIFI信号的强度信息,将待定位点WIFI信号的强度信息与位置指纹库进行预匹配,获得候选位置指纹;采用确定性匹配法,在候选的位置指纹中,选取与待定位点改进欧式距离最近的Kd个位置指纹的位置信息的加权平均值作为待定位点的位置(X1,Y1);采用概率性匹配法,在候选的位置指纹中,取与待定位点联合概率最大的Kp个位置指纹的位置信息的加权平均值作为待定位点的位置(X2,Y2);根据待定位点的位置(X1,Y1)和(X2,Y2)计算待定位点。本发明专利技术采用改进欧式距离的计算方法,减小了WIFI信号波动对定位结果的影响,提高定位精度。

【技术实现步骤摘要】

本专利技术涉及一种室内定位方法,特别涉及一种基于WIFI信号强度的室内定位方法,属于定位导航

技术介绍
随着移动互联网的高速发展,基于位置服务的需求量不断扩大,基于位置服务的基础与关键是定位技术。室外定位技术的发展已经较为完善,有基于卫星的定位技术和基于基站的定位技术,定位精度能够满足需求。室内定位技术的实现依赖于现有的无线通讯技术。作为一种无线通讯技术,WIFI技术以其设备成本低、布局简易、通信速度快、发射功率小、无需额外添置硬件的优势成为了发展室内定位技术的重要研究方向。基于WIFI技术的室内定位方法主要包括三种:基于邻近关系的定位方法、基于三角关系的定位方法、基于场景分析的定位方法。(1)基于邻近关系的定位方法基于邻近关系的定位方法根据待定位点与已知位置的WIFI热点的邻近关系进行定位,当待定位点的移动端接收到一个或者多个已知位置的WIFI热点信号,信号强度最大的WIFI热点的位置就被认为是待定位点的位置。这种定位方法的精度取决于WIFI热点的密度和信号范围。(2)基于三角关系的定位方法基于三角关系的定位方法根据三角形的几何性质来确定待定位点的位置,当待定位点的移动端接收到一个或者多个已知位置的WIFI热点信号,通过测量这些信号的到达角度或传播距离,由三个或者三个以上的已知位置的WIFI热点可以计算出待定位点的位置。根据测量方法的不同,可以细分为基于角度的三角定位方法和基于距离的三角定位方法,而基于距离的三角定位法又可以细分为传播时间法和传播模型法。基于三角关系的定位方法最大的缺点是需要提前预知WIFI热点位置。(3)基于场景分析的定位方法基于场景分析的定位方法是对已知的室内定位环境进行抽象化和形式化,用一些具体的、量化的位置特征描述室内定位环境中的离散的已知位置,并把这些已知位置的特征集成在一起生成位置特征库。定位时根据待定位点的位置特征查询位置特征库,采取特定的匹配规则,用已知的WIFI热点位置来估计出待定位点的位置。位置指纹定位方法是一种典型的基于场景分析的定位方法,它主要分为两个阶段:离线阶段和在线阶段。离线阶段是根据已知的室内定位环境,按照一定的间隔距离确定若干采样点,形成一个采样点的网格,以每个采样点采集的信号强度信息加上采样点的位置信息(相对或绝对位置)组成数据元组,这些数据元组称为位置指纹。在线阶段是将待定位点测量到的信号强度信息与位置指纹库中的信号强度信息按照一定的规则进行匹配,找到与待定位点信号强度信息“相似”的一个或若干个位置指纹,最终用这些位置指纹的位置信息估计出待定位点的位置信息。信号强度信息主要包括两个部分:信号强度特征值以及对应的WIFI热点的标识(一般以WIFI热点的物理地址作为标识)。根据匹配时选取的信号强度特征值不同,待定位点与位置指纹的匹配方法分为确定性匹配方法和概率性匹配方法。确定性匹配方法选取的信号强度特征是一定采样时间内信号强度做平滑去噪处理后的平均值,匹配规则是比较待定位点与位置指纹的欧式距离,取欧氏距离最近的位置指纹的位置信息作为待定位点的位置或取欧氏距离最近的K个位置指纹的位置信息的平均值作为待定位点的位置。概率性匹配方法选取的信号强度特征值是一定采样时间内信号强度未做任何处理的平均值和标准差,匹配规则是比较待定位点与位置指纹的联合概率,取联合概率最大的位置指纹的位置信息作为待定位点的位置或取联合概率最大的K个位置指纹的位置信息的平均值作为待定位点的位置。位置指纹定位方法因为不需要提前预知WIFI热点位置和定位精度较高的优势成为了基于WIFI技术的室内定位方法的主要研究方向。已有的位置指纹定位方法存在以下不足:①位置指纹库庞大导致匹配时间过长。②以传统欧式距离为匹配标准的确定性匹配方法对WIFI信号波动影响的考虑不足。③以联合概率为匹配标准的概率性匹配方法在克服WIFI信号波动影响具有明显优势,但是其定位结果主要决定于联合概率值最大的某一个位置指纹,对于定位结果取K个位置指纹加权后的平均值的方法并不适用。
技术实现思路
有鉴于此,本专利技术的目的是针对上述已有技术存在的不足,提出一种基于WIFI信号强度的室内定位方法,该方法能够实现准确的室内定位。实现本专利技术的技术方案如下:一种基于WIFI信号强度的室内定位方法,具体过程为:步骤一、在室内环境选取若干采样点,采集采样点处WIFI信号的强度信息,将所述强度信息和采样点位置信息组成位置指纹,得到位置指纹库;步骤二、采集待定位点WIFI信号的强度信息,将待定位点WIFI信号的强度信息与位置指纹库进行预匹配,获得候选位置指纹;步骤三、采用确定性匹配法,在候选的位置指纹中,选取与待定位点改进欧式距离最近的Kd个位置指纹的位置信息的加权平均值作为待定位点的位置(X1,Y1);采用概率性匹配法,在候选的位置指纹中,取与待定位点联合概率最大的Kp个位置指纹的位置信息的加权平均值作为待定位点的位置(X2,Y2);假设待定位点可以收到n个WIFI热点信号,预匹配后有m个候选位置指纹,改进的欧氏距离的定义如式(1),di=Σk=1n(|PAVGk-PAVGik|+DEV+DEVi)2---(1)]]>其中,i=1,2,...,m,k=1,2,...,n,di表示待定位点与第i个候选位置指纹的改进欧氏距离,DEV表示待定位点的信号强度的原始标准差,DEVi表示第i个候选位置指纹的信号强度的原始标准差,PAVGk表示待定位点收到的第k个WIFI热点的信号强度的处理平均值,PAVGik表示第i个候选位置指纹收到的第k个WIFI热点的信号强度的处理平均值;步骤四、根据待定位点的位置(X1,Y1)和(X2,Y2)计算待定位点。进一步地,本专利技术采样点所对应的位置指纹表示形式为AP=(ID,MAC,AVG,PAVG,DEV),其中ID表示采样点的标识,MAC表示WIFI热点的物理地址,AVG表示信号强度的原始平均值,PAVG表示信号强度的处理平均值,DEV表示信号强度的原始标准差。进一步地,本专利技术所述预匹配为:首先,找出待定位点中PAVG>FLAG情况下的MAC,其中FLAG为预设的信号强度阈值;然后,在位置指纹库中,选取包含所找出的MAC的位置指纹,并将其作为候选位置指纹。进一步地,本专利技术所述联合概率的定义如式(3)所示,Pi=Pi1·Pi2·...·Pik·...·Pin       (3)其中,P本文档来自技高网
...
一种基于WIFI信号强度的室内定位方法

【技术保护点】
一种基于WIFI信号强度的室内定位方法,其特征在于,具体过程为:步骤一、在室内环境选取若干采样点,采集采样点处WIFI信号的强度信息,将所述强度信息和采样点位置信息组成位置指纹,得到位置指纹库;步骤二、采集待定位点WIFI信号的强度信息,将待定位点WIFI信号的强度信息与位置指纹库进行预匹配,获得候选位置指纹;步骤三、采用确定性匹配法,在候选的位置指纹中,选取与待定位点改进欧式距离最近的Kd个位置指纹的位置信息的加权平均值作为待定位点的位置(X1,Y1);采用概率性匹配法,在候选的位置指纹中,取与待定位点联合概率最大的Kp个位置指纹的位置信息的加权平均值作为待定位点的位置(X2,Y2);假设待定位点可以收到n个WIFI热点信号,预匹配后有m个候选位置指纹,改进的欧氏距离的定义如式(1),di=Σk=1n(|PAVGk-PAVGik|+DEV+DEVi)2---(1)]]>其中,i=1,2,...,m,k=1,2,...,n,di表示待定位点与第i个候选位置指纹的改进欧氏距离,DEV表示待定位点的信号强度的原始标准差,DEVi表示第i个候选位置指纹的信号强度的原始标准差,PAVGk表示待定位点收到的第k个WIFI热点的信号强度的处理平均值,PAVGik表示第i个候选位置指纹收到的第k个WIFI热点的信号强度的处理平均值;步骤四、根据待定位点的位置(X1,Y1)和(X2,Y2)计算待定位点。...

【技术特征摘要】
1.一种基于WIFI信号强度的室内定位方法,其特征在于,具体过程为:
步骤一、在室内环境选取若干采样点,采集采样点处WIFI信号的强度信息,
将所述强度信息和采样点位置信息组成位置指纹,得到位置指纹库;
步骤二、采集待定位点WIFI信号的强度信息,将待定位点WIFI信号的强
度信息与位置指纹库进行预匹配,获得候选位置指纹;
步骤三、采用确定性匹配法,在候选的位置指纹中,选取与待定位点改进
欧式距离最近的Kd个位置指纹的位置信息的加权平均值作为待定位点的位置
(X1,Y1);采用概率性匹配法,在候选的位置指纹中,取与待定位点联合概率最大
的Kp个位置指纹的位置信息的加权平均值作为待定位点的位置(X2,Y2);
假设待定位点可以收到n个WIFI热点信号,预匹配后有m个候选位置指纹,
改进的欧氏距离的定义如式(1),
di=Σk=1n(|PAVGk-PAVGik|+DEV+DEVi)2---(1)]]>其中,i=1,2,...,m,k=1,2,...,n,di表示待定位点与第i个候选位置指纹的改进欧
氏距离,DEV表示待定位点的信号强度的原始标准差,DEVi表示第i个候选位置
指纹的信号强度的原始标准差,PAVGk表示待定位点收到的第k个WIFI热点的
信号强度的处理平均值,PAVGik表示第i个候选位置指纹收到的第k个WIFI热
点的信号强度的处理平均值;
步骤四、根据待定位点的位置(X1,Y1)和(X2,Y2)计算待定位点。
2.根据权利要求1所述基于WIFI信号强度的室内定位方法,其特征在于,
所述联合概率的定义如式(3)所示,
Pi=Pi1·Pi2·...·Pik·...·Pin  (3)

\t其中,Pi表示待定位点与第i个候选位置指纹的联合概率,Pik表示第i个候选位
置指纹收到的第k个WIFI热点的信号强度的独立概率,其计算方法为:
对于正态分布公式(4),
f(x)=1σ2πe-(x-μ)22σ2---(4)]]>令μ=AVGik,σ=DEVik,其中AVGik和DEVik表示第i个候选位置指纹收到的第
k个WIFI...

【专利技术属性】
技术研发人员:马锐郭强马科王勇单纯
申请(专利权)人:北京理工大学
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1